Glossary
Some terminology that may be used in this description includes:
- Shelfwear
- Minor wear resulting from a book being place on, and taken from a bookshelf, especially along the bottom edge.

- Tight
- Used to mean that the binding of a book has not been overly loosened by frequent use.
